2017-11-01 2 views
0

Ich verwende vue and vue router.Vue-Router, entfernen Sie Hash auf einigen Seiten

Standardmäßig wird #/ zu den URLs hinzugefügt. Ich möchte einige Seiten als PHP und andere Seiten von Vue-Router gerendert haben.

Beispiele

Ich möchte alle diese arbeiten:

  • example.com
  • example.com/#/some/query/
  • example.com/about
  • example.com/about#/some/query/

Ist es möglich?

+0

Haben Sie versucht, einen Web-Proxy einzurichten, um die Anfrage an statische Datei (von vue) und Laravel umzuleiten? – imcvampire

Antwort

1

Am Ende, ja - es ist möglich. Aber das Mischen verschiedener Modi ist im Allgemeinen eine schlechte Idee - es wird zu Unordnung in der Architektur führen. Wählen Sie den History- oder Hash-Modus und machen Sie Ihre Anwendung konsistent, indem Sie nur eine davon verwenden.

+0

Ich habe gerade meinen Weg gefunden, um mit der Geschichte übereinzustimmen. Vielen Dank! –

+0

@ JensTörnell Gern geschehen :) – WaldemarIce

Verwandte Themen